Mc Gehee Municipal is a non-towered airport in Mc Gehee, AR. Nobody clears you to do anything: you self-announce on the CTAF, 122.9, as Mc Gehee Municipal Traffic, with the airport name at the start and end of each call.
No Class B, C, D or E surface area is designated for this airport in the FAA data, so the airspace at the surface is Class G.

Sample calls at 7M1
Mc Gehee Municipal has no operating control tower. Every call below goes out on the CTAF, 122.9, to the other aircraft, not to a controller. The runway shown is 18; use whichever runway the wind and the traffic dictate on the day.
The aircraft is the AIM’s own example, Cessna Three One Six Zero Foxtrot; the squawk codes, altitudes and headings are illustrative. Frequencies, station names and runway numbers are this airport’s, from the FAA data.
- Tune 122.9. Nobody clears you; you announce and you listen. The airport name goes at the start and the end of every call, and the runway is always a number, never "the active" (AIM 4-1-9 g 8).
- YouMc Gehee Municipal traffic, Cessna Three One Six Zero Foxtrot, taxiing to runway one eight, Mc Gehee Municipal.
- YouMc Gehee Municipal traffic, Cessna Six Zero Foxtrot, departing runway one eight, departing the pattern to the north, Mc Gehee Municipal.
- Announce until you are about 10 miles out; on the way back, start announcing at 10 miles (AIM 4-1-9 c 1, TBL 4-1-1).
- YouMc Gehee Municipal traffic, Cessna Three One Six Zero Foxtrot, one zero miles south, two thousand five hundred, landing Mc Gehee Municipal, Mc Gehee Municipal.
- YouMc Gehee Municipal traffic, Cessna Six Zero Foxtrot, entering left downwind runway one eight, full stop, Mc Gehee Municipal.
- YouMc Gehee Municipal traffic, Cessna Six Zero Foxtrot, left base runway one eight, Mc Gehee Municipal.
- YouMc Gehee Municipal traffic, Cessna Six Zero Foxtrot, final runway one eight, full stop, Mc Gehee Municipal.
- YouMc Gehee Municipal traffic, Cessna Six Zero Foxtrot, clear of runway one eight, Mc Gehee Municipal.
If things change. Do not use "any traffic in the area, please advise"; the AIM says it is not to be used under any condition (AIM 4-1-9 g 1). Listen for ten miles before you arrive; most of what you want to know has already been said.
